Which company offers the cheapest car insurance rates in Idaho?

Based on data analysis by CarInsurance.com, Auto-Owners provides the cheapest full coverage auto insurance rates for Idaho drivers at a monthly rate of $76 or $916 a year.

A full coverage policy bundles liability insurance, which is required by most states, with optional coverages like comprehensive and collision. These additional coverages come with a deductible, meaning you’ll have to pay a set amount out-of-pocket before your insurance kicks in.

Find out which insurance company offers the cheapest car insurance rates for full coverage in Idaho.

Cheapest car insurance rates in Idaho per month

CompanyFull coverage monthly rates
Auto-Owners$76
State Farm$93
Geico$98
Travelers$105
Nationwide$125
Farmers$134
Farm Bureau$138
Allstate$162
Sentry Insurance$196
USAA*$62

Note: USAA is only available to military community members and their families.

Cheapest companies for state minimum coverage in Idaho

Idaho requires all drivers to carry a minimum amount of car insurance, known as the state’s minimum coverage requirements. It means that your policy must include at least:

Minimum coverageMinimum limit
Minimum bodily injury liability$25,000/$50,000
Minimum property damage liability$15,000

Below are the average annual rates from major insurance companies in Idaho, ranked from cheapest to the most expensive for the state minimum coverage.

CompanyState minimum annual rates
Auto-Owners$190
Geico$201
State Farm$244
Travelers$323
Farm Bureau$337
Farmers$406
Allstate$484
Sentry Insurance$567
Nationwide$645
USAA*$170

Note: USAA is only available to military community members and their families.

Cheapest liability-only coverage in Idaho

Your liability-only coverage will cover the cost of property damage or bodily injury you cause in an accident, up to the policy limits.

Below, you’ll see average annual rates for major insurance providers in Idaho, ranked from cheapest to most expensive for liability insurance coverage. The coverage limit for the below-mentioned rates is $50,000 for bodily injury per person, $100,000 for bodily injury per accident and $50,000 for property damage.

CompanyLiability only annual rates
Auto-Owners$252
Geico$257
State Farm$322
Travelers$405
Farm Bureau$423
Allstate$517
Farmers$579
Nationwide$690
Sentry Insurance$748
USAA*$209

Note: USAA is only available to military community members and their families.

Cheapest car insurance in Idaho, by driving history

Your driving history affects how much you pay for insurance in Idaho because insurance companies use it to assess the risk associated with insuring a driver.

Traffic violations such as speeding tickets, DUIs and at-fault accidents demonstrate risky behavior on the road. Insurance companies view these violations as indicators of higher risk and may charge you higher premiums.

A driver with a history of traffic violations pays $362 more annually in Idaho than an individual with a clean driving record.

Cheap car insurance rates after a speeding ticket in Idaho

If you’ve got a speeding ticket on your Idaho driving record and need affordable car insurance, Geico might be the answer. With an average annual rate of $842, Geico offers the cheapest full coverage auto insurance options for drivers with speeding tickets in Idaho.

CompanyRates before speedingAfter speeding (1-29 mph over limit)% difference$ difference
Geico$760$84211%$81
Auto-Owners$698$93334%$234
State Farm$932$1,0149%$83
American Family$1,141$1,1884%$47
Travelers$906$1,30744%$400
Nationwide$899$1,48866%$589
Farmers$1,377$1,72025%$343
Allstate$1,694$1,96116%$268
USAA*$696$87826%$181

Note: USAA is only available to military community members and their families.

Cheap car insurance rates after a DUI conviction in Idaho

CarInsurance.com analyzed insurance rates for Idaho drivers with DUI convictions and we found that State Farm provides the cheapest car insurance rates at an average annual premium of $1,014. American Family is the second-cheapest insurer at an average of $1,188 per year.

A DUI can significantly impact your car insurance costs. On average, drivers with clean records pay 39% less than drivers with a DUI on their record.

Company Rates before DUIRates after a DUI% difference$ difference
State Farm$932$1,0149%$83
American Family$1,141$1,1884%$47
Travelers$906$1,36450%$457
Auto-Owners$698$1,583127%$884
Farmers$1,377$1,76428%$388
Nationwide$899$1,994122%$1,095
Allstate$1,694$2,27634%$583
Geico$760$2,337207%$1,577
USAA*$696$1,451108%$755

Note: USAA is only available to military community members and their families.

Cheap car insurance companies in Idaho after an at-fault accident

The car insurance company with the cheapest driver rates after an at-fault accident is Auto-Owners, at $799 a year.

On the other hand, State Farm offers the second-cheapest full-coverage car insurance rates for drivers with a history of at-fault accidents at an average annual premium of $1,097.

When you are responsible for an accident, it can have a significant impact on your insurance premiums. Insurance companies generally consider at-fault accidents an indicator of increased risk, which leads to increased premiums.

CompanyRates before accidentRates after accident% difference$ difference
Auto-Owners$698$79914%$101
State Farm$932$1,09718%$165
American Family$1,141$1,1884%$47
Geico$760$1,25064%$489
Travelers$906$1,27140%$364
Nationwide$899$1,34249%$443
Farmers$1,377$1,98744%$610
Allstate$1,694$2,56151%$867
USAA*$696$1,02046%$324

Note: USAA is only available to military community members and their families.

Resources & Methodology

Methodology

CarInsurance.com commissioned Quadrant Information Services to field rates in 2023 from all the major insurers in nearly every ZIP code of Idaho for three different coverage levels:

  • Full coverage policy with limits 100/300/100, including comprehensive and collision coverage and a $500 deductible.
  • Liability-only with limits 50/100/50.
  • State-minimum car insurance limits of 25/50/15.

The rates are based on the sample profile of a 40-year-old male and female driving a Honda Accord LX with a clean driving record and a good credit score. We have compared 53,409,632 car insurance quotes from 75 company groups across 34,588 ZIP Codes.

Violations:

Car insurance rates are calculated by evaluating the sample profile of a 40-year-old driver for a full coverage policy with limits 100/300/100, including comprehensive and collision coverage, and a $500 deductible, with the following incidents applied: clean record, at-fault accident, DUI conviction and speeding ticket.

Discounts:

Car insurance discount rates are for a full coverage policy with limits of 100/300/50 and a $500 comprehensive and collision deductible based on the sample profile of a 40-year-old male driver. To gather the data, our data experts compared 2,677,890 insurance quotes across various ZIP Codes.

The rates are for comparison purposes only and your exact rates may vary.
